Lifecycle of Whorled Pennywort

๐ŸŒฑ Germination Stage

Conditions for Germination

Whorled pennywort seeds thrive in optimal temperatures ranging from 20ยฐC to 25ยฐC (68ยฐF to 77ยฐF). They require consistent moisture in a nutrient-rich substrate and can grow in partial shade to full sun.

Duration of Germination

Seeds typically germinate within 7 to 14 days. Factors such as temperature, moisture levels, and seed viability can influence this duration.

๐ŸŒฟ Seedling Stage

Characteristics of Seedlings

Seedlings display a whorled arrangement of small, rounded leaves. They creep along the substrate, establishing roots, and usually reach an initial height of 2 to 4 inches.

Duration of Seedling Growth

It takes about 2 to 4 weeks for seedlings to become established. Indicators of establishment include the development of secondary roots and an increase in leaf size.

๐ŸŒณ Vegetative Growth Stage

Description of Vegetative Growth

During this stage, whorled pennywort exhibits rapid horizontal expansion, forming dense mats. The leaves become larger and more pronounced, while the root system grows extensively to aid in nutrient uptake and stabilization.

Duration of Vegetative Growth

This growth phase lasts approximately 4 to 8 weeks, depending on environmental conditions. Water quality, nutrient availability, and light exposure significantly affect this duration.

๐ŸŒธ Flowering Stage

Description of Flowering

Whorled pennywort produces small, inconspicuous flowers that typically emerge above the water. The plant is primarily self-pollinating and attracts aquatic insects, with flowering often occurring in late spring to early summer.

Duration of Flowering

The flowering period lasts around 2 to 4 weeks. Environmental triggers such as water temperature and daylight length play a crucial role in this phase.

๐ŸŒพ Seed Production Stage

Process of Seed Production

After pollination, seeds develop in capsules. Water currents assist in dispersing these seeds to new locations, ensuring the plant's spread.

Duration of Seed Production

It takes about 3 to 6 weeks for seeds to mature after flowering. Environmental conditions and the success of pollination can influence this timeline.

โณ Growth Rate and Maturation

Maturation Time

Whorled pennywort typically matures in 3 to 6 months, reaching full size. Factors like water quality, nutrient levels, and light conditions can impact this maturation process.

Factors Affecting Growth Rate

High nutrient availability promotes faster growth, while slow-moving, clear water enhances growth rates. Optimal light conditions also lead to vigorous growth.

Average Growth Rate

Under ideal conditions, whorled pennywort can grow up to 1 inch per week. However, growth rates may slow in less-than-ideal environments.

Environmental Adaptations

Whorled pennywort can thrive in fluctuating aquatic environments, demonstrating tolerance to varying water levels. It adjusts leaf orientation based on sunlight availability and has efficient nutrient absorption mechanisms in nutrient-rich waters.

Changes in Reproductive Strategies

Initially, the plant relies on vegetative propagation for rapid spread through runners. As it matures, it shifts to sexual reproduction, using flowering and seed production to enhance genetic diversity. In response to environmental stress, it increases seed production to ensure survival.
